Yesterday William Kennedy was in and we schooled quite a few of the horses and this morning everything just did one or two canters.
We were so disappointed with Ben Buie and Dreamsundermyfeet’s runs in the Bumper at Newbury on Saturday and they are both going for overground scopes this morning to hopefully find out what is stopping them. Dreamer gargled from early on in the race and Ben Buie was going well until he stopped far too quickly turning for home. Both horses are lovely horses for the future but we need to find out what is going on. Matt Capp is coming here to accompany me and it will be good to catch up with him.
Racing today and Back on the Lash goes to Market Rasen under Richard Johnson who was in the saddle when they won last time at Ludlow over 2 miles. It’s a step up in trip but we think that should suit him and are hopeful of another big run.
Matravers was going to run on the flat but he’s got a stone bruise so misses that engagement. We’ve had a frustrating time of late with him so hopefully he’ll gain compensation soon.
